What Does a Cosmetic Dentist Do?

A cosmetic dentist focuses on improving the appearance of teeth, gums, and smile harmony while protecting oral health. Depending on the case, treatment may also improve bite balance, tooth strength, and hygiene access.

Common services include:

  • Teeth whitening

  • Veneers

  • Dental bonding

  • Clear aligners

  • Crowns for worn or damaged teeth

  • Gum contouring

  • Smile makeover planning

The right cosmetic dentistry blends natural aesthetics with long-term function.

Signs It May Be Time to Visit a Cosmetic Dentist

You Avoid Smiling in Photos

If you consistently hide your smile, cover your mouth, or feel self-conscious in pictures, cosmetic care may help address the reasons behind that discomfort.

Your Teeth Are Stained or Discolored

Deep stains from coffee, wine, smoking, aging, or previous dental trauma often do not respond fully to store-bought whitening products.

Chips, Cracks, or Uneven Edges Are Visible

Minor damage can make teeth look older or less symmetrical. Bonding or veneers may improve appearance while protecting enamel.

Gaps or Mild Crookedness Bother You

Spacing and alignment concerns can often be treated with clear aligners or cosmetic reshaping.

Old Dental Work Looks Noticeable

Older fillings, crowns, or mismatched restorations may stand out. Modern materials are designed to look more natural.

Cosmetic Dentistry Is Not Just About Looks

This is one of the biggest misconceptions. Many cosmetic treatments also provide practical benefits.

For example:

  • Straightening crowded teeth may improve cleaning access

  • Rebuilding worn teeth can improve bite comfort

  • Replacing damaged restorations can reduce future complications

  • Repairing chips can prevent worsening fractures

What Happens During a Cosmetic Consultation?

A quality consultation usually includes:

Smile Evaluation

The provider examines teeth, gums, bite alignment, and facial balance.

Discussion of Goals

Patients explain what they like, dislike, and hope to improve.

Treatment Options

Multiple approaches may be offered depending on budget, timeline, and desired results.

Health First Planning

Any gum disease, decay, or structural issues are typically addressed before cosmetic work begins.

This process helps ensure the plan is realistic, healthy, and customized.

When Is the Right Time to Start?

There is no “perfect age” for cosmetic dentistry. Adults of many ages choose treatment when a smile concern begins affecting confidence or function.

Good times to consider treatment may include:

  • Before weddings or special events

  • After orthodontic relapse

  • Following tooth wear or damage

  • When replacing outdated dental work

  • After achieving better oral health habits

The right timing is when expectations are clear and oral health is stable.
